1 Kings 9:22-24
King James Version
22 But of the children of Israel did Solomon make no bondmen: but they were men of war, and his servants, and his princes, and his captains, and rulers of his chariots, and his horsemen.
23 These were the chief of the officers that were over Solomon's work, five hundred and fifty, which bare rule over the people that wrought in the work.
24 But Pharaoh's daughter came up out of the city of David unto her house which Solomon had built for her: then did he build Millo.

1 Kings 9:22-24
New King James Version
22 But of the children of Israel Solomon (A)made no forced laborers, because they were men of war and his servants: his officers, his captains, commanders of his chariots, and his cavalry.
23 Others were chiefs of the officials who were over Solomon’s work: (B)five hundred and fifty, who ruled over the people who did the work.
24 But (C)Pharaoh’s daughter came up from the City of David to (D)her house which [a]Solomon had built for her. (E)Then he built the Millo.
